Precision Drilling Spindle Head

Updated: 2026-08-03

Overview

The precision drilling spindle head is a specialized mechanical component integral to high-accuracy drilling applications. It is engineered to deliver exceptional rotational stability and minimal runout, ensuring precise hole placement and surface finish. Commonly integrated into CNC machining centers, these spindle heads are vital for industries requiring micron-level accuracy, such as aerospace and medical device manufacturing. Modern spindle heads often incorporate advanced materials like ceramic bearings and alloy housings to enhance durability and reduce thermal deformation. Their design focuses on minimizing vibration and maintaining consistent performance under high-speed operations, making them indispensable for automated production lines.

Structure and Working Principle

A precision drilling spindle head typically consists of a motorized spindle, bearings (angular contact or ceramic), a tool holder (e.g., ER collet), and a cooling system. The spindle rotates at high speeds (often exceeding 10,000 RPM) driven by an integrated motor or belt system, while the bearings ensure minimal friction and axial/radial load support. The working principle revolves around converting electrical energy into precise rotational motion, which is transmitted to the drilling tool. Advanced models may include feedback systems like encoders to monitor speed and position, further enhancing accuracy. Cooling mechanisms (air or liquid) are critical to dissipate heat generated during prolonged operation.

Key Features

High rotational accuracy (often within 1-5 microns) is the hallmark of these spindle heads, achieved through precision-ground components and balanced assemblies. Low vibration is another critical feature, ensured by dynamic balancing and rigid construction, which directly impacts hole quality and tool life. Thermal stability is addressed through materials with low thermal expansion coefficients and integrated cooling systems. Additionally, modular designs allow for quick tool changes, reducing downtime in industrial settings. Some models offer programmable speed and torque adjustments to accommodate diverse materials.

Application Areas

Precision drilling spindle heads are widely used in CNC machining centers for tasks like drilling micro-holes in aerospace components (e.g., turbine blades) or creating intricate molds for injection molding. The automotive industry relies on them for engine part manufacturing, while electronics manufacturers use them for PCB drilling. Other applications include medical device production (e.g., surgical instruments) and woodworking for high-end furniture. Their versatility also extends to composite material processing, where clean, burr-free holes are essential.

Maintenance and Precautions

Regular maintenance is crucial to prolong the spindle head's lifespan. This includes periodic lubrication of bearings (if not sealed), cleaning of cooling channels, and inspection of tool holders for wear. Overloading the spindle or operating beyond recommended speeds can lead to premature failure. Thermal monitoring is advised during continuous operation to prevent overheating. Proper alignment during installation ensures optimal performance, and using compatible tool holders avoids imbalance issues. Storage in a dust-free, dry environment prevents corrosion.

B2B Procurement Guide

When sourcing precision drilling spindle heads, prioritize suppliers with proven expertise in industrial machinery components. Key specifications to evaluate include maximum RPM, torque output, compatibility with existing CNC systems, and cooling requirements. Certifications like ISO 9001 can indicate quality reliability. Consider total cost of ownership, factoring in energy efficiency and maintenance needs. For high-volume procurement, negotiate service agreements for technical support and spare parts availability. Customization options (e.g., specific tool interfaces) may be available for specialized applications.
